The Royal Hotel
One of Perth's newest and oldest venues. First open in 1882, the Royal Hotel has just opened its 2019 iteration, a modern Australian pub. Enjoy contemporary plates and counter meals in the saloon downstairs or kick back with table service upstairs. You do you.
